

As climate disruption reshapes landscapes, politics, and daily life, a deeper question lingers beneath the headlines: How do we live—fully, honestly, boldly—within this moment? Where do we turn for steadiness and imagination as we find our way forward?
Join climate leader Dr. Katharine K. Wilkinson (co-editor of All We Can Save) and celebrated poet Jane Hirshfield for readings and a conversation about Dr. Wilkinson’s new book, Climate Wayfinding. Together, they will explore how we orient ourselves within a changing world and what poetry can offer those of us seeking courage, clarity, and pathways to contribution.
Whether you are steeped in climate work or newly curious, whether poetry is a familiar companion or something you rarely encounter, you’ll leave this conversation feeling nourished, grounded, and more equipped for the journey ahead.
